Avocado toast apparently became a certified Big Deal a few years back because Gwyneth Paltrow put it in her "It's All Good" cookbook in 2013, but I'm sure many people, have been enjoying it way before just like I have.
Nevertheless, in the interest of making you wiser, here are some interesting facts about avocado toast.
- It can range from 400 to 700 calories per serving
- It seems to have first appeared on a menu in 1993, in Australia
- According to Google Trends, interest in avocado toast has grown steadily since 2013
- New York produces the most searches for avocado toast; Washington DC is second
- A casual survey of prices shows that toast dishes can range from $4 to well over $20, depending on toppings
- Possible toast toppings include egg, crab, tuna, pomegranate, pumpkin seeds, sprouts, shrimp, arugula, chickpeas, bacon, tomato, dukkah, roasted garlic and hemp seeds... Or anything that you like really.
